The Ark of the Mist-Maids! (Table of Contents: 1)

Kaänga / comic story / 14 pages (report information)

Script
Frank Riddell
Pencils
Maurice Whitman; Iger Shop
Inks
Iger Shop
Colors
?
Letters
?

Genre
jungle
Characters
Kaänga; Zulu; Marmo (elephant); Wasumbas (African tribe); N'toba; Lutoa; Songa
Synopsis
The Wasumbas witch, Lutoa, is poisoning the chief so that her confederate, N'toba, can seize the chieftanship. Kaänga exposes her plot. N'tonga is killed by animals captured for a funeral sacrifice and Lutoa is captured.
Reprints
Keywords
bondage; funerary customs; hawks; leopards; lions; longboats; net traps; poisoning; tiger traps; waterfalls; white monkeys

Indexer Notes

The first four pages appear to be pencilled by Whitman, but the rest of the story, and the inks, seem to be by Iger Shop personnel.

[no title indexed] (Table of Contents: 3)

Captain Terry Thunder / comic story / 4.75 pages (report information)

Script
Pierre La Rue
Pencils
Gus Schrotter ?
Inks
Jack Kamen ?; Iger Shop
Colors
?
Letters
?

First Line of Dialogue or Text
Activity inside the hot, sun-baked walls of Fort Diablo, stronghold of Congo justice, had fallen into a dull and listless routine.
Genre
jungle; adventure
Characters
Terry Thunder; Keeto; Baron Lorne; L'tongas (African tribe); N'kotas (African tribe); Wazulis (African tribe)
Synopsis
As Terry attempts to settle a border dispute between tribes, both parties are attacked by ape men, who are, in reality, disguised henchmen of Baron Lorne who has discovered diamonds in the area and wants both tribes driven out. Terry exposes the imposture and Lorne and his men are taken prisoner.
Reprints
Keywords
animal hides; Basuto Boundary; diamonds; disguises; helicopters; totem poles; trophies

Indexer Notes

The bottom-one quarter of the final page is a subscription advertisement for Jungle Comics.

[no title indexed] (Table of Contents: 9)

Camilla / comic story / 8 pages (report information)

Script
Victor Ibsen (house name)
Pencils
Ralph Mayo
Inks
Ralph Mayo
Colors
?
Letters
?

First Line of Dialogue or Text
A tiny camp lies hidden in a clump of baobab trees...
Genre
jungle
Characters
Camilla; Fang; King Cobra; Mike Morgan; Chet; N'zuli; Warundi; K'bangi (African tribe)
Synopsis
King Cobra's gang is raiding pygmy funeral barges and taking sacred gold. King himself is beginning to feel remorse for the native killed in these raids. He attempts suicide but manages to only wound himself. He succumbs to amnesia and is befriended by Camilla. His gang seize him from her and plan new raids. Camilla promises to help the pygmies defend their barges. King warns Camilla about the coming raid, allowing her to prevent it. King recovers his memory and Camilla takes the entire gang to the coast and prison.
Keywords
amnesia; dynamite; funerary customs; saddle zebras; suicide
